Handover: the Relay circuit breaker guards calls to the upstream quotes API. It trips after five consecutive failures, holds open for 60 seconds, then half-opens with a single probe request. Thresholds live in `breaker.conf`; change them only with load-test evidence. Fallback serves cached quotes up to ten minutes old. Metrics are on the service dashboard. Ownership sits with the engineer named below.

account owner for bawip-tahag: Raleth Quenok

Finance Review — Ostermill Term Sheet

Quick recap for heads of department: Ostermill Group's term sheet came in better than expected — valuation up, board seat demands down. Warranty caps still need a trim, and the earn-out window feels tight. Deva's team is redlining this week. The confidential note on where this fits our broader plans sits just below.

board note of yadup-fajef: Druiusox Holdings is in early talks to buy Norwynek Systems for about $186.0 million. The Kaseth launch date is June 24, and nothing goes to the press before then. Legal wants the Quenethek Group term sheet withdrawn before November 27.

Onboarding note for the Torvane release manager: the firmware update channel pushes signed bundles to the beta ring every Thursday. Promotion to stable requires a second approval in the console. The channel admin account is shared and rotates quarterly. Should it lock you out mid-release, regain access with the recovery passphrase below.

unlock words, hahip-baduf: holwyn-istath-julvan

Runbook: TerraTally Offline Mode

For this week's sync: field crews in the Dunmore basin pilot lose connectivity for hours at a time, so TerraTally now caches survey forms locally and queues submissions in SQLite until a link returns. Sync order is strictly FIFO; conflicts are resolved server-side by last-write with an audit flag. If the queue exceeds 500 entries, the app throttles new captures and surfaces a banner. These are the current values the offline agent reads at startup.

service settings:
WENATH_PIN=5007
WENATH_METRICS_HOST=metrics.wenath.tolvaqlabs.corp
WENATH_LOG_LEVEL=debug
WENATH_TENANT=rusox